          This OMNIBUS AMENDMENT (this “Omnibus Amendment”), dated as of June 20, 2007, by and among Cardinal Health Funding, LLC (“Funding”), Griffin Capital, LLC, individually and as Servicer under and as defined in the Receivables Purchase Agreement referred to below (“Griffin” or “Servicer”), each entity signatory hereto as a Conduit (each a “Conduit” and collectively, the “Conduits”), each entity signatory hereto as a Financial Institution (each a “Financial Institution” and, collectively with the Conduits, the “Purchasers”), each entity signatory hereto as a Managing Agent (each a “Managing Agent” and collectively, the “Managing Agents”) and JPMorgan Chase Bank, N.A. (successor by merger to Bank One, NA (Main Office Chicago)), as the Agent (the “Agent”).
RECITALS
          Funding, Servicer, the Purchasers, the Managing Agents and the Agent have entered into that certain Second Amended and Restated Receivables Purchase Agreement, dated as of October 31, 2006 (the “Receivables Purchase Agreement”), which amended and restated that certain Amended and Restated Receivables Purchase Agreement, dated as of May 21, 2004, as amended from time to time (the “Prior Receivables Purchase Agreement”).
          In connection with the Receivables Purchase Agreement, Griffin and Funding entered into that certain Amended and Restated Receivables Sale Agreement, dated as of May 21, 2004, as amended by the Omnibus Amendment thereto, dated as of August 18, 2004, and as further amended by the Omnibus Limited Waiver and Second Omnibus amendment thereto, dated as of September 24, 2004 (as so amended, the “Receivables Sale Agreement”).
          Griffin and Cardinal Health 110, Inc. (“CH 110”) have entered into that certain Second Amended and Restated Receivables Purchase and Sale Agreement, dated as of May 21, 2004 (the “CH 110 Griffin RPA”).
          Cardinal Health 411, Inc. (“CH 411”) desires to become a party to that certain Receivables Purchase and Sale Agreement, dated as of the date hereof (the “Effective Date”), by and between Griffin and CH 411 (the “CH 411 Griffin RPA”) upon the terms and conditions set forth therein.
          The parties hereto desire to amend certain provisions of the Receivables Purchase Agreement and the Receivables Sale Agreement as more fully described herein.
